Cadillac Key Types We Cut & Program
Cadillac security runs from the famous VATS resistor keys on classic DeVilles and Sevilles, through PK3+ transponders, to today's proximity fobs on the Escalade and XT models. We stock VATS keys in all resistor values plus current fobs, and program everything on site.

Cadillac Escalade Key Replacement
Escalade fobs are the most-requested single key in our luxury work. Early trucks (through 2006) use PK3 transponder remote-heads; 2007–2014 adds better remotes; and 2015+ Escalades are proximity-fob-only with remote start, power liftgate and running-board control baked in.

Cadillac CTS Key Replacement
The CTS moved through PK3+ remote-head keys (2003–2007), flip keys (2008–2013), and proximity fobs (2014–2019). The flip-key generation has the classic GM hinge wear; the proximity generation hides an emergency blade many owners never find until we show them.

Cadillac XT5 Key Replacement
Every XT5 (2017 on) is proximity-key: push-button start, hands-free liftgate, remote start on the fob. Replacement is a programming job we do at your driveway — and because the XT5 succeeded the SRX, we cover that model's 2010–2016 remote and flip keys under the same roof.
XT5 owners usually reach us for a second fob after a used purchase, or when the only fob starts responding intermittently after a hot Vegas summer in a pocket. Heat is hard on fob batteries and boards; we test which one failed before recommending anything.

Cadillac DeVille Key Replacement
Classic DeVilles are VATS country: the resistor-pellet keys Cadillac pioneered in the late 80s run through the 90s fleet, with PK3 transponders taking over around 2000. VATS keys come in 15 pellet values, and cutting one correctly requires measuring the original circuit — equipment we still carry when most shops have thrown theirs out.
DeVille owners are long-term owners, and we help keep these cars driving: correct VATS keys cut on site, worn ignition and door cylinders rebuilt rather than replaced when originality matters, and spares made before the last key becomes a museum piece.

Can you make a Cadillac key if I lost all my keys?
Yes. As a NASTF-registered Vehicle Security Professional we retrieve the key code for your Cadillac by VIN, cut the key on site and program it to the immobilizer — no tow to the dealership.
